So, I got this car about 2 years ago. At first I had no plans for it, but then I started reading magazines, talking with friends and I started to like the idea of body kits/etc and what not, so I got some Z3 Fenders and an R34 bumper and had plan to finish it off with some other pieces. Then I found Honda-Tech.

I started visiting this site frequently. Not only did I learn a lot about my car, and about Hondas in general, but I also caught a nasty case of the JDM bug. So I started reading more on it and what not and started to like to look of lips, 15 inch wheels, that sort of thing. I had started collecting random JDM parts, headlights, corner pieces, etc.. And then the unthinkable happened.

One 1/3 of this year, I was driving to my girlfriends house and my car was making this werid windy noise. I thought it was a belt, pump or something and I'd check it when I got home. It was an automatic and it was shifting funny, I really didn't put the noise and that together at the time. My girlfriend lived on a hill and as I was driving up, my car totally lost power to the wheels. . I got it to like 4000 on my tach and I went nowhere, then I knew my automatic tranny had went.

I never figured out why, I always changed the fluid regulary, althought it did have 150k miles on it. So, I shopped around and some shop wanted $2000 to put ANOTHER automatic tranny in it, I said expletive that and started thinking about the idea of a tranny swap, and I read that it wasn't all that big of a process, although it had a lot of parts needed I felt that I could definitely get it done.

LOL!

Okay, this is what I have so far..

Tranny (JDM S20)
D series Shift linkage
OEM clutch/flywheel
Shifter
Shift ****
Hydraulic Lines
Clutch Resovir
Slave/Master Cylindar
Full manual pedal assembly from an EH2

Now, the other parts you need are:

Manual ECU (for whichever motor your running)
New console piece.
Shiftboot
auto/manual mount

Now, for the mount. You CAN use an OEM manual one, but you WILL HAVE TO WELD IT. The auto/manual ones are a direct bolt up. Now you can get these from jdmshit.com and hasport.com. Hasport is 175 I believe, and JDMshit is 120 shipped, both are good from what I've read.
